Transaction 53d256278ce71ac32376f34e57c4c7236b4e7c19cc1abd576e8702ecde51a2f6

12 Input
2 Outputs
  • 53d256278ce71ac32376f34e57c4c7236b4e7c19cc1abd576e8702ecde51a2f6:0
  • value  20413868
    address  1DkxoQKdJhi9EKJQGUSCfd794xka2LSZ1a
  • 53d256278ce71ac32376f34e57c4c7236b4e7c19cc1abd576e8702ecde51a2f6:1
  • value  1004224
    address  3AYrZ4tiFWWXQTzZCqddMSeA7GH41Q4BBG